How Regularly Should You Take Your Pet To The Vet in Rapid Bay SA?

Typically, if you have a healthy and balanced dog, it would only need to see you local Rapid Bay vet at least once a year for a basic appointment. It is rather different for brand-new puppies as well as older pet dogs.

New puppies will certainly need multiple check ups with the veterinarian in their very first 6 months. They will need to see the vet for their initial exam, pup vaccinations, heartworm (plus flea and tick) prevention, as well as for neutering. Whilst, senior dogs over 7 years will require at least two check-ups per year.

What Are The Different Kinds of Vet Hospitals in Rapid Bay SA?

Put simply, a veterinarian is essentially a pet medical professional. There are numerous kinds of veterinarians in Rapid Bay SA but listed here are the 5 primary types of vets.

Companion pet veterinarians: Veterinarians who work with companion animals like canines and pet cats.

Livestock veterinarians: Vets that work with tamed farm animals.

Exotic animal veterinarians: Veterinarians that usually work with reptiles, birds as well as tiny creatures like rodents and ferrets.

Mixed practice vets: Vets who deal with both small and also big pets.

Lab animal medicine veterinarians: Veterinarians who work in labs that are responsible for the wellness of a variety of animals on account of science.

Animal Vaccinations

Just like humans, regular or annual vaccinations for dogs as well as felines are needed for good health. Shots for cats and canines will safeguard your family pet from potentially serious and fatal illness. Local veterinarians in Rapid Bay SA can advise you to get a custom preventative healthcare prepare for your animal, which has regular pet cat or dog vaccinations. No matter your dogs breed or cats breed, vaccinations are important.

Typical diseases including parvovirus, hard pad disease, contagious canine hepatitis, as well as canine cough can be prevented by inexpensive yearly shots for canines.

FVRCP vaccine for felines and also other shots for cats will certainly ensure long-term immunity towards transmittable and also preventable diseases.

Cat and Canine Cardiology Treatment

Heart problems in pets as well as pet cats are extra widespread as they age however it is not an unusual health condition for pet dogs of any ages. Your pet cat or dog may call for a cardiac test if they have the adhering to symptoms of heart troubles in canines and also cats: uncommon heart beats, heart whisperings, respiratory problems, fainting, exercise intolerance, and also weakness.
